This checklist will include detailed information about the documents that need to gather including the reference letters, background check, financial and medical forms, proof of employment and more.

"Private adoption agencies in Florida show you how to organize and prepare for this house visit. One of the most common examples of confusion has to do with the background checks. The reason this surprises people is because you have to make sure that everyone above the age of 11, who lives in the house submits a background check. Another example is the reference letters. If you've worked with children in the past five years, you must submit a reference letter from your employer at that job. These are the small details that can have a big impact on the process and you need to be aware of them."
